Understanding Itchy Scalp: Causes, Symptoms, and Solutions

An itchy scalp can be more than just a minor annoyance; it can significantly impact your daily life and overall well-being. The causes of an itchy scalp are diverse, and identifying the specific trigger is the first step toward finding relief. Below, we explore the most common causes, symptoms, and solutions for an itchy scalp.
Common Causes of Itchy Scalp
1. Dry Skin : One of the most frequent causes of an itchy scalp is dry skin. This can result from cold weather, excessive washing, or using harsh hair products that strip the scalp of its natural oils.
2. Dandruff : Dandruff is a common condition characterized by flaky, itchy skin on the scalp. It is often caused by an overgrowth of a naturally occurring yeast on the scalp or an imbalance in the scalp’s microbiome.
3. Allergic Reactions : Certain hair care products, such as shampoos, conditioners, or styling products, can cause allergic reactions or irritation, leading to an itchy scalp.
4. Scalp Infections : Fungal or bacterial infections, such as ringworm or folliculitis, can cause itching, redness, and discomfort on the scalp.
5. Stress and Anxiety : Psychological factors like stress and anxiety can exacerbate scalp itchiness, as they may trigger or worsen skin conditions.
Symptoms Associated with Itchy Scalp
An itchy scalp often presents with additional symptoms, such as:
- Flaking or visible dandruff
- Redness or inflammation
- Burning or tingling sensations
- Hair loss or thinning in severe cases
Solutions and Preventive Measures
1. Moisturize Regularly : Using a gentle, hydrating shampoo and conditioner can help combat dryness and restore moisture to the scalp.
2. Choose the Right Products : Opt for hypoallergenic or fragrance-free hair care products to minimize the risk of irritation or allergic reactions.
3. Maintain Scalp Hygiene : Regular washing with a mild shampoo can help prevent the buildup of oils and dead skin cells that contribute to itchiness.
4. Address Underlying Conditions : If an infection or skin condition is suspected, consult a healthcare professional for appropriate treatment options.
5. Manage Stress : Incorporating stress-reducing practices, such as meditation or exercise, can help alleviate stress-related scalp issues.
